OU Leads with Nine All-Big 12 Selections

NORMAN, Okla. – The second-ranked Oklahoma women's gymnastics team earned a conference-best nine spots on the 2012 All-Big 12 Gymnastics Team announced by the league Wednesday.

This marks the fifth straight season that OU led the conference in All-Big 12 selections.  The Sooners have had at least eight selections in all five years.

The All-Big 12 squad consists of the top three conference gymnasts with the highest regional qualifying score (RQS) in each event and the top two in the all-around.

Seniors Megan Ferguson and Sara Stone earned All-Big 12 honors on all three events they compete. 
Ferguson was selected on bars, beam and floor, while Stone was named All-Big 12 on vault, beam and floor.

Brie Olson earned the honor on both vault and bars while Taylor Spears was selected on beam.

Ferguson has 10 career All-Big 12 selections.  The Olathe, Kan., native has earned all-conference honors on bars and beam all four years and made the team for floor the last two seasons.

Stone has earned All-Big 12 honors on vault all four seasons of her career and is currently ranked No. 1 in the country on the apparatus.  Stone also made the all-conference team for floor in 2011.

Spears was selected for beam for the second straight season while Olson earned her first career All-Big 12 honor.

OU starts the postseason playing host to the 2012 Big 12 Championship on Saturday, March 24 at 4 p.m., at the Lloyd Noble Center.
